Giveon: Coachella 2026

Content Visuals & Notch Treatments

Created for Giveon's Coachella 2026 mainstage performance, this project explored how the qualities of analogue film could be translated into a live, real-time environment. Working in collaboration with Dreamachine Studio and Show Designers Douglas Green and 1826 Studio, I developed a series of design studies exploring grain, halation, bloom, colour response and image degradation. These explorations informed a flexible visual system in Notch that evolved throughout the performance as the show transitioned from sunset into night.

Alongside the live camera treatments, I created a series of visual environments including cinematic gradients and a stylised architectural world inspired by the Hollywood Bowl. Combined with Dreamachine Studio's content, these elements formed a warm and filmic visual language that carried through both the live performance and broadcast.
